  • Steve Bentley

    June 7, 2018 at 9:44 pm in reply to: Getting odd colours with GifGun

    Noise makes any compression do more work – there are more colors to consider and you will (usually) end up with a larger file because there is more information.

    FFMpeg will compress GIFs and there’s GIFsicle.

    With the vector look, you could also set a custom pallet of fewer colors at a lower bit depth (we use an old copy of debabelizer to do this). If you pre-reduce the colors that are fed into the compression software, it has less to do and what comes out the other end is smaller in mb and more tailored to the colors that are there. (so like 30,000 colours or even 256 instead of the 16.7 million you get with 8bit)

    As for your orange to green problem – its possible that orange is not in the gamut for a GIF and because there are no graduations or variations of that color it just gets changes in the LUT (although all the over to a green seems bizzare). Adding noise creates those variations (kind of like a dither would) and allows the LUT to approximate a color closer to the original even though the exact one might not exist in the GIF world.
    The alternative to noise would be to shift that color slightly in the original until it compresses to something more reasonable.

  • Steve Bentley

    June 7, 2018 at 9:36 pm in reply to: Lenscare vs PGBokeh vs…?

    For stills, lightwave’s full blown go-and-have-a-long-meal-render version of DOF has always been the most natural. It fell apart however with animation and there were visible artifacts that popped in and out.

    AE’s camera blur is just a blur. It tries, but you don’t get any bokeh, but then you don’t get any bokeh really really fast.

    While the Nuke plug in version seems nice at the outset, I’ve found lots of scenes where it creates an almost vector look to thinks – too sharp or something. The bokeh becomes disks far to easily. This is great for makeup ads but not much else.

    Lens Care Seems to bridge the gap nicely between being realistic and fast enough. (is anything every truly fast enough?) And its also a personal preference issue. Some people like the look of a leica lens and some people like the look of big-glass pentax’s – so what is “realistic” to you?
    And with the controls available in Lens Care and the custom iris (try a high contrast dandelion puff – it creates gorgeous bokeh!) you can really zero in on the ethereal.
    Its not as fast as I would like (especially at higher bit depths and large frame sizes) but I find the wait worth it.

  • Steve Bentley

    June 7, 2018 at 5:43 pm in reply to: Why Does My Zoom In Hook Around Like This?

    If you can upload the project we can take a look.
    Keep in mind that scaling is exponential – as you “zoom in” it gets faster and faster – when you scale something 200% it gets 4 times bigger. Scale it 4 times and its 16 times bigger; whereas a camera moving at a constant rate will look, well, constant.
    Also with a lens involved, as objects approach the edge of the frame they tend to warp a little as they “round” the lens. The effect is higher in the horizontal rather than the vertical due to the side edges of a landscape shaped frame being closer to the edge of a round lens. You can use the distort/optics compensation effect to simulate this – it really adds a nice true camera feel.

  • So I take it Jim, that you are using the RF plug in within C4d and you can do your sims within C4d correct? In that case, I’ve been talking out of my hat. We use RF, and I assumed the OP was too, using RF as a standalone program. (we do it this way so we can also use RF with houdini etc as well).

    If the c4d sim plugin works with dynamics that might be a good reason to use the plug in within C4D. What we normally have to do is bring a stunt object into standalone RF and let it bump into the fluid there in order to sim the reacting mesh before we import the final mesh (collisions and all) into C4d.
    On the downside, I don’t think some of the sheeting algorithms are available in the plug in version.

  • You might have to join the points of the two spline’s end points to make them one big spline (which you can only do once you have connected them – select the end points of each and hit “join” from the mesh/spline menu).
    I’m not sure what the two helixes would look like or if your’s meet at both ends. If the do, you also have to reverse the direction of one of the splines so that the direction keeps going same way as you go around the circuit so you can make them one big spline.

  • Steve Bentley

    June 6, 2018 at 4:43 pm in reply to: Time remap using luminance or control layer

    First, each box would be a precomp and in the precomp would be a timeline of all the animations that box should do. Could you not then use expressions in the outer comp to sample the luminence at the spot a particular box sits at and then send the play head of that precomped box to the frame appropriate to that luminence level?
